Breaking Down the Features of Kimble/Kontes KIMAX Solution Bottles with Color-Coded PTFE ST Flathead Stopper, Kimble Chase 15097 1000

Specifications

  • The Kimble/Kontes KIMAX Solution Bottles with Color-Coded PTFE ST Flathead Stopper, Kimble Chase 15097 1000 has a capacity of 1000 mL (34 oz). This ample volume is ideal for collecting multiple samples at once, reducing the number of trips to a sampling location.
  • The bottle features a ST (Standard Taper) 29 stopper size. This ensures a tight, reliable seal with the PTFE stopper, minimizing the risk of leaks or contamination.
  • The stopper is color-coded green. The color-coding makes it easy to quickly identify the contents or origin of the sample, vital in situations where multiple samples need to be managed.
  • This Kimble Chase product has the Kimble Chase No.: 15097 1000. This specific identifier guarantees you are receiving a product that meets strict manufacturing standards, essential for scientific applications.

These specifications are crucial for maintaining sample integrity and simplifying workflow in demanding outdoor environments. The accurate volume measurement allows for precise calculations during analysis, while the color-coded stopper prevents accidental mix-ups.

Pros and Cons of Kimble/Kontes KIMAX Solution Bottles with Color-Coded PTFE ST Flathead Stopper, Kimble Chase 15097 1000

Pros

  • Chemically Inert: KIMAX glass ensures no leaching or contamination of samples.
  • Accurate Calibration: Meets ASTM E438, Type 1, Class A standards for precise volume measurements.
  • Secure Seal: The PTFE stopper provides a leak-proof and airtight closure.
  • Durable Construction: KIMAX glass is resistant to thermal shock and chemical attack.
  • Color-Coded Stopper: Simplifies identification and organization of multiple samples.

Cons

  • Narrow Mouth: Requires careful pouring to avoid spills.
  • Glass Construction: Susceptible to breakage if dropped or mishandled.
